Searched refs:getRegister (Results 1 - 25 of 82) sorted by relevance

1234

/freebsd-11-stable/contrib/llvm-project/llvm/lib/CodeGen/AsmPrinter/
H A DAsmPrinterDwarf.cpp220 OutStreamer->EmitCFIDefCfa(Inst.getRegister(), Inst.getOffset());
223 OutStreamer->EmitCFIDefCfaRegister(Inst.getRegister());
226 OutStreamer->EmitCFIOffset(Inst.getRegister(), Inst.getOffset());
229 OutStreamer->EmitCFIRegister(Inst.getRegister(), Inst.getRegister2());
238 OutStreamer->EmitCFISameValue(Inst.getRegister());
247 OutStreamer->EmitCFIRestore(Inst.getRegister());
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DSIMachineFunctionInfo.h546 return ArgInfo.WorkGroupIDX.getRegister();
552 return ArgInfo.WorkGroupIDY.getRegister();
558 return ArgInfo.WorkGroupIDZ.getRegister();
564 return ArgInfo.WorkGroupInfo.getRegister();
584 return ArgInfo.PrivateSegmentWaveByteOffset.getRegister();
670 return Arg ? Arg->getRegister() : Register();
694 return ArgInfo.PrivateSegmentWaveByteOffset.getRegister();
740 return ArgInfo.QueuePtr.getRegister();
744 return ArgInfo.ImplicitBufferPtr.getRegister();
860 return ArgInfo.WorkGroupIDX.getRegister();
[all...]
H A DSIMachineFunctionInfo.cpp193 return ArgInfo.PrivateSegmentBuffer.getRegister();
200 return ArgInfo.DispatchPtr.getRegister();
207 return ArgInfo.QueuePtr.getRegister();
215 return ArgInfo.KernargSegmentPtr.getRegister();
222 return ArgInfo.DispatchID.getRegister();
229 return ArgInfo.FlatScratchInit.getRegister();
236 return ArgInfo.ImplicitBufferPtr.getRegister();
441 OS << printReg(Arg.getRegister(), &TRI);
H A DR600ExpandSpecialInstrs.cpp144 R600::R600_TReg32RegClass.getRegister((DstBase * 4) + Chan);
244 DstReg = R600::R600_TReg32RegClass.getRegister((DstBase * 4) + Chan);
H A DR600InstrInfo.cpp1043 getIndirectAddrRegClass()->getRegister(Address));
1056 buildMovInstr(MBB, MI, getIndirectAddrRegClass()->getRegister(Address),
1103 unsigned Reg = R600::R600_TReg32RegClass.getRegister((4 * Index) + Chan);
1128 case 0: AddrReg = R600::R600_AddrRegClass.getRegister(Address); break;
1129 case 1: AddrReg = R600::R600_Addr_YRegClass.getRegister(Address); break;
1130 case 2: AddrReg = R600::R600_Addr_ZRegClass.getRegister(Address); break;
1131 case 3: AddrReg = R600::R600_Addr_WRegClass.getRegister(Address); break;
1160 case 0: AddrReg = R600::R600_AddrRegClass.getRegister(Address); break;
1161 case 1: AddrReg = R600::R600_Addr_YRegClass.getRegister(Address); break;
1162 case 2: AddrReg = R600::R600_Addr_ZRegClass.getRegister(Addres
[all...]
H A DAMDGPUArgumentUsageInfo.cpp30 OS << "Reg " << printReg(getRegister(), TRI);
H A DAMDGPUArgumentUsageInfo.h71 Register getRegister() const { function in struct:llvm::ArgDescriptor
H A DR600EmitClauseMarkers.cpp179 R600::R600_KC0RegClass.getRegister(UsedKCache[j].second));
183 R600::R600_KC1RegClass.getRegister(UsedKCache[j].second));
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/AMDGPU/Utils/
H A DAMDGPUPALMetadata.h61 unsigned getRegister(unsigned Reg);
/freebsd-11-stable/contrib/llvm-project/libunwind/src/
H A DUnwindCursor.hpp541 _msContext.Rax = r.getRegister(UNW_X86_64_RAX);
542 _msContext.Rcx = r.getRegister(UNW_X86_64_RCX);
543 _msContext.Rdx = r.getRegister(UNW_X86_64_RDX);
544 _msContext.Rbx = r.getRegister(UNW_X86_64_RBX);
545 _msContext.Rsp = r.getRegister(UNW_X86_64_RSP);
546 _msContext.Rbp = r.getRegister(UNW_X86_64_RBP);
547 _msContext.Rsi = r.getRegister(UNW_X86_64_RSI);
548 _msContext.Rdi = r.getRegister(UNW_X86_64_RDI);
549 _msContext.R8 = r.getRegister(UNW_X86_64_R8);
550 _msContext.R9 = r.getRegister(UNW_X86_64_R
[all...]
H A DDwarfInstructions.hpp67 return (pint_t)((sint_t)registers.getRegister((int)prolog.cfaRegister) +
84 return (pint_t)addressSpace.getRegister(cfa + (pint_t)savedReg.value);
87 return (pint_t)addressSpace.getRegister(evaluateExpression(
95 return registers.getRegister((int)savedReg.value);
248 pint_t sp = newRegisters.getRegister(UNW_REG_SP);
708 *(++sp) = registers.getRegister((int)reg);
715 *(++sp) = registers.getRegister((int)reg);
754 svalue += static_cast<sint_t>(registers.getRegister((int)reg));
763 svalue += static_cast<sint_t>(registers.getRegister((int)reg));
H A DRegisters.hpp49 uint32_t getRegister(int num) const;
124 inline uint32_t Registers_x86::getRegister(int regNum) const { function in class:libunwind::Registers_x86
256 uint64_t getRegister(int num) const;
341 inline uint64_t Registers_x86_64::getRegister(int regNum) const { function in class:libunwind::Registers_x86_64
570 uint32_t getRegister(int num) const;
690 inline uint32_t Registers_ppc::getRegister(int regNum) const { function in class:libunwind::Registers_ppc
1136 uint64_t getRegister(int num) const;
1250 inline uint64_t Registers_ppc64::getRegister(int regNum) const { function in class:libunwind::Registers_ppc64
1779 uint64_t getRegister(int num) const;
1849 inline uint64_t Registers_arm64::getRegister(in function in class:libunwind::Registers_arm64
2205 inline uint32_t Registers_arm::getRegister(int regNum) const { function in class:libunwind::Registers_arm
2590 inline uint32_t Registers_or1k::getRegister(int regNum) const { function in class:libunwind::Registers_or1k
2805 inline uint32_t Registers_mips_o32::getRegister(int regNum) const { function in class:libunwind::Registers_mips_o32
3118 inline uint64_t Registers_mips_newabi::getRegister(int regNum) const { function in class:libunwind::Registers_mips_newabi
3395 inline uint32_t Registers_sparc::getRegister(int regNum) const { function in class:libunwind::Registers_sparc
3582 inline uint64_t Registers_riscv::getRegister(int regNum) const { function in class:libunwind::Registers_riscv
[all...]
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/Sparc/
H A DSparcISelDAGToDAG.cpp70 return CurDAG->getRegister(GlobalBaseReg,
140 R2 = CurDAG->getRegister(SP::G0, TLI->getPointerTy(CurDAG->getDataLayout()));
235 PairedReg = CurDAG->getRegister(GPVR, MVT::v2i32);
282 PairedReg = CurDAG->getRegister(GPVR, MVT::v2i32);
357 TopPart = CurDAG->getRegister(SP::G0, MVT::i32);
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/ARM/
H A DARMISelDAGToDAG.cpp108 Reg = CurDAG->getRegister(ARM::CPSR, MVT::i32);
834 Offset = CurDAG->getRegister(0, MVT::i32);
853 Offset = CurDAG->getRegister(0, MVT::i32);
887 Offset = CurDAG->getRegister(0, MVT::i32);
903 Offset = CurDAG->getRegister(0, MVT::i32);
932 Offset = CurDAG->getRegister(0, MVT::i32);
1051 Offset = CurDAG->getRegister(0, MVT::i32);
1578 CurDAG->getRegister(0, MVT::i32), Chain };
1588 CurDAG->getRegister(0, MVT::i32), Chain };
1619 CurDAG->getRegister(
[all...]
/freebsd-11-stable/contrib/llvm-project/llvm/lib/CodeGen/
H A DExecutionDomainFix.cpp248 LLVM_DEBUG(dbgs() << printReg(RC->getRegister(rx), TRI) << ":\t" << *MI);
340 const int Def = RDA->getReachingDef(mi, RC->getRegister(rx));
342 return RDA->getReachingDef(mi, RC->getRegister(I)) <= Def;
446 for (MCRegAliasIterator AI(RC->getRegister(i), TRI, true); AI.isValid();
H A DCFIInstrInserter.cpp172 SetRegister = CFI.getRegister();
181 SetRegister = CFI.getRegister();
H A DMachineOperand.cpp606 printCFIRegister(CFI.getRegister(), OS, TRI);
622 printCFIRegister(CFI.getRegister(), OS, TRI);
629 printCFIRegister(CFI.getRegister(), OS, TRI);
641 printCFIRegister(CFI.getRegister(), OS, TRI);
648 printCFIRegister(CFI.getRegister(), OS, TRI);
661 printCFIRegister(CFI.getRegister(), OS, TRI);
679 printCFIRegister(CFI.getRegister(), OS, TRI);
685 printCFIRegister(CFI.getRegister(), OS, TRI);
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/AArch64/MCTargetDesc/
H A DAArch64AsmBackend.cpp592 getXRegFromWReg(*MRI.getLLVMRegNum(Inst.getRegister(), true));
611 unsigned LRReg = *MRI.getLLVMRegNum(LRPush.getRegister(), true);
612 unsigned FPReg = *MRI.getLLVMRegNum(FPPush.getRegister(), true);
633 unsigned Reg1 = *MRI.getLLVMRegNum(Inst.getRegister(), true);
640 unsigned Reg2 = *MRI.getLLVMRegNum(Inst2.getRegister(), true);
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/Mips/
H A DMipsSEISelDAGToDAG.cpp80 return Mips::MSACtrlRegClass.getRegister(RegNum);
254 SDValue Zero = CurDAG->getRegister(Mips::ZERO, MVT::i32);
820 CurDAG->getRegister(Mips::ZERO_64, MVT::i64),
958 CurDAG->getRegister(Mips::HWR29, MVT::i32),
1042 SDValue ZeroVal = CurDAG->getRegister(
1066 SDValue ZeroVal = CurDAG->getRegister(Mips::ZERO, MVT::i32);
1089 SDValue ZeroVal = CurDAG->getRegister(Mips::ZERO, MVT::i32);
1145 SDValue ZeroVal = CurDAG->getRegister(Mips::ZERO, MVT::i32);
1202 SDValue Zero64Val = CurDAG->getRegister(Mips::ZERO_64, MVT::i64);
H A DMipsISelDAGToDAG.cpp69 return CurDAG->getRegister(GlobalBaseReg, getTargetLowering()->getPointerTy(
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/Lanai/
H A DLanaiISelDAGToDAG.cpp132 Base = CurDAG->getRegister(Lanai::R0, CN->getValueType(0));
145 Base = CurDAG->getRegister(Lanai::R0, CN->getValueType(0));
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/XCore/
H A DXCoreISelDAGToDAG.cpp120 Reg = CurDAG->getRegister(XCore::CP, MVT::i32);
123 Reg = CurDAG->getRegister(XCore::DP, MVT::i32);
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64RegisterInfo.cpp94 UpdatedCSRs.push_back(AArch64::GPR64commonRegClass.getRegister(i));
162 for (MCSubRegIterator SubReg(AArch64::GPR64commonRegClass.getRegister(i),
210 markSuperRegs(Reserved, AArch64::GPR32commonRegClass.getRegister(i));
H A DAArch64SelectionDAGInfo.cpp75 TagSrc = DAG.getRegister(AArch64::SP, MVT::i64);
/freebsd-11-stable/contrib/llvm-project/llvm/lib/Target/ARC/
H A DARCISelDAGToDAG.cpp54 Reg = CurDAG->getRegister(ARC::STATUS32, MVT::i32);

Completed in 647 milliseconds

1234